What is BEINSTMOD.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. Each DLL file can be used by more than one program to perform certain tasks, like printing or connecting to a network. BEINSTMOD.dll is a specific DLL file that plays an important role in the functioning of the software Sophos SafeGuard.

This file is responsible for managing the installation, modification, and removal processes of the Sophos SafeGuard software. In the context of Sophos SafeGuard, BEINSTMOD.dll is crucial for ensuring that the software is installed correctly and continues to function properly. Without this DLL file, the installation and modification of Sophos SafeGuard could encounter errors or malfunctions, potentially leading to issues in the proper functioning of the software and compromising the security of the computer system.

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:

  • This application failed to start because BEINSTMOD.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
  • BEINSTMOD.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• BEINSTMOD.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
  • BEINSTMOD.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message implies that there could be an error within the DLL file, or the DLL is not compatible with the Windows version you're running. This could occur if there's a mismatch between the DLL file and the Windows version or system architecture.
  • BEINSTMOD.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the BEINSTMOD.dll Error

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the BEINSTMOD.dll Error Thumbnail
Difficulty
Expert
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will fix BEINSTMOD.dll errors by scanning Windows system files.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
